Output 69e950f9540191c119aae5667c981a53715f6ef81eb2c5778eccd588bb4a6f55:5

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 f8435f32180768f0aa7e06644fa1aff52843f455
address
bc1qlpp47vscqa50p2n7qejylgd0755y8az4pc6ccl
transaction
69e950f9540191c119aae5667c981a53715f6ef81eb2c5778eccd588bb4a6f55
confirmations
108049
spent
true